From the smallest fish to high-stakes professional poker play now, every Rush, but how do I go to the thing at the best approach? For those who do not already know: Rush Poker is a new feature of Full Tilt Poker. It is the variant of choice for action-junkies, for as soon as you click on the Fold button, one is immediately put to a new table, which begins in the same second a new hand. There is no waiting time - after the fold to get new cards with no transition. There is even a quick-fold button, which allows you to fold his hand before it is ever on the series.

Rush Poker Strategy 2. - The obviously most important innovations

The biggest difference to the traditional poker game is that it instantly catapults with a fold to a new table. So there is no history with the opponents more. Each hand is synonymous with a new table and new enemies. You do not know who the fish are and who the pros. All opponents are blank slates. Since it is not possible to develop Reads by playing multiple hands against certain players, you have to behalndeln every opponent the same. Natpürlich that goes for everyone else at the table. If you get a read on the opponent, it also does not get read to you. So you have a lot less to worry about, to vary his game or his range, because you will rarely meet frequently with individual opponents.

Rush Poker Strategy 4. - The not so obvious changes

The possibility of Quick Fold the whole game is changed. The players are not on a good hand. You simply throw away bad cards and sit on the next table at the next hand, where else they had to endure several minutes waiting time. This means that opponents will play much tighter in general. The fish do, of course, the, m what they always do: they play marginal hands and go with it too long. The good Spüieler but play a lot less hands than normal. This is the Quick-Fold button. When you sit with 8-6o in the small blind, then wait until your turn, and consider whether a steal now makes sense? No. Instead, you QuickFold and go to the next table.

Rush Poker Strategy 7. - Rakeback

If the game is not brand new and have developed more players have a sound strategy, you will note my view that it is the rakeback that makes Rush Poker attractive. Rush eight tables (four 6-max and four full ring) mean about 2000 poker hands per hour. In these 2000 hands we generated approximately $ 100 - Rake at a 27% quota bsind the rakeback alone $ 27 per hour. If this level can also beat even that is quite a nice income.
